Conceptual framework for development of an instrument to measure students' CNC machining skill

Abstract

This paper proposes a conceptual framework for measuring CNC Machining skill of diploma level technical students. This framework describes CNC machining skills and the relevant concepts, theories, and variables of machining skill development to prepare students to become a CNC Machinist or CNC Technician. The framework is based on three primary phases: a) input phase based upon the literature review, b) process phase based upon the rationales consolidated from the input phase which includes data collection and analysis, and c) output phase which is to establish the core and supporting tasks needed in a job. The framework can be used to guide the development of an educational or training program in CNC Machining Technology. It can also provide feedback to instructors seeking to improve the effectiveness of technology training. This is in alignment with the National Occupational Skill Standard (NOSS) which describes the knowledge, skills and abilities required to perform machining tasks in the industry. © 2014 IEEE.
